Abstract

Envenomation by is very frequent in Iran, especially in the south-west This scorpion is one of the six scorpions whose venom is used to prepare anti-venom. Using HPLC, we discovered venom components of varies from one specimen to another depending on geographical location, and this result is confirmed by those first found in various symptoms of sting in envenomed persons from two separate geographical places (north and south of Khuzestan province). There was a significant relationship between symptoms and location of envenomation by . Muscle spasm was more dominant in envenomed people from Northern cities, and venom chromatogram analysis showed the presence of at least six main sharp peaks in Northern rather than Southern . It shows intraspecific differences in venom of that must be considered in treatment of stung people from different geographical locations as well as in the preparation of anti-venom. 摘要

在伊朗,尤其是西南部地区,[蝎子名称未给出]蜇伤极为常见。这种蝎子是六种其毒液被用于制备抗蛇毒血清的蝎子之一。通过高效液相色谱法,我们发现[蝎子名称未给出]的毒液成分因标本所处地理位置不同而存在差异,这一结果也得到了来自胡齐斯坦省两个不同地理位置(北部和南部)被蜇伤者不同症状的印证。[蝎子名称未给出]蜇伤的症状与蜇伤地点之间存在显著关联。肌肉痉挛在北部城市的被蜇伤者中更为常见,毒液色谱分析显示北部[蝎子名称未给出]毒液中至少有六个主要尖峰,而南部的则不然。这表明[蝎子名称未给出]毒液存在种内差异,在治疗来自不同地理位置的蜇伤者以及制备抗蛇毒血清时都必须予以考虑。另见图1(图1)。
